Breaking Down the Features of Sawyer MINI Water Filtration System Black

Specifications

  • The Sawyer MINI utilizes a 0.1 micron absolute filtration system. This removes 99.99999% of all bacteria, like salmonella, cholera, and E. coli.
  • It also removes 99.9999% of all protozoa, such as giardia and cryptosporidium, and 100% of microplastics. These percentages are extremely important for water safety.
  • It weighs just 2 ounces, making it incredibly lightweight and portable. This is a game-changer for backpacking.
  • The filter is rated for up to 100,000 filtered gallons. This provides an exceptionally long lifespan.
  • It can be attached to the included drinking pouch, used with the included straw, connected to hydration pack tubing, or screwed onto standard disposable water and soda bottles. This versatility is a major selling point.

These specifications are crucial because they directly impact the safety and convenience of obtaining clean water in the outdoors. The high filtration rate gives peace of mind, while the lightweight design and multiple attachment options make it incredibly versatile.

Performance & Functionality

The Sawyer MINI Water Filtration System Black excels at its primary function: providing safe drinking water. The filter reliably removes bacteria, protozoa, and microplastics, making questionable water sources potable.

The flow rate is initially a bit slow, especially with the included pouch, but it improves after the filter is broken in. A stronger squeeze helps. While the Sawyer MINI meets expectations for portability and filtration, the flow rate could be improved.

Design & Ergonomics

The Sawyer MINI is a marvel of minimalist design. Its compact size and light weight make it incredibly easy to pack and carry.

The build quality is robust. It uses durable materials that have held up well under heavy use. The design is user-friendly, with intuitive attachment options and a simple backflushing process. There’s virtually no learning curve.

Durability & Maintenance

Given its solid construction, the Sawyer MINI is built to last. The Sawyer company rates it for up to 100,000 gallons.

Maintenance is incredibly simple. Regular backflushing with the included syringe prevents clogging and prolongs the filter’s lifespan. The ease of maintenance ensures the Sawyer MINI remains a reliable tool for years to come.

Accessories and Customization Options

The Sawyer MINI comes with a 16-ounce reusable squeeze pouch, a 7-inch drinking straw, and a cleaning syringe. These provide everything you need to get started.

While there aren’t extensive customization options, the Sawyer MINI is compatible with most standard water bottles and hydration packs. This compatibility allows for flexible integration into your existing gear setup.
